A renal transplant patient presents with rising creatinine and elevated liver function tests. He also has low-grade fever and malaise. CMV PCR comes back positive. What is the most likely cause of his current condition?
A) Acute rejection
B) Drug-induced hepatotoxicity
C) CMV infection
D) Hepatitis C reactivation
Correct answer: C) CMV infection
